Toplou Monastery

Toplou Monastery
The monastery was founded in the 14th century. It was destroyed and rebuilt several times by pirates and in 1612 by a severe earthquake. Like other Cretan abbeys, Toplou was a refuge for partisans during Ottoman rule. In 1821, Turks massacred 13 monks and 13 lay people.
During the German occupation, Cretan resistance fighters operated a radio station here. The Nazis executed the abbot and two monks in 1944

The monastery is famous for its icon museum, which has sadly been closed
